Answer: 47 and 16
Step-by-step explanation:
- Make Two Equations
x + y = 63
x - y = 31
- Set one of the equations equal to one of the variables
x + y = 63
x = 31 + y
- Substitute the equation back into the other one
(31 + y) + y = 63
31 + 2y = 63
2y = 32
y = 16
- Substitute the answer back into the equation
x + y = 63
x + 16 = 63
x = 47

A standard deck of cards has 52 cards. Half of the deck has red cards and half has black cards. So the first probability would be 26/52, or 1/2 (simplified, it's half the deck).
Then you put the card back and choose a 3. There are 4 cards with the number 3 in the deck. So it's 4/52.
Then you multiply both the probabilities
26/52 x 4/52 =

= 1/26
